How do inaccurate supply chain reports affect CBAM tax calculation outcomes?
Incomplete or inconsistent supply chain emission reports interfere with standard tax computation algorithms adopted by EU customs and fiscal authorities. Non-compliant data submissions often trigger upward tax adjustment mechanisms and compulsory cost rectification procedures for inbound industrial shipments.
A common mistake is that frontline forwarding staff adopt generic default emission factors to accelerate CBAM declaration processes for urgent client shipments. Generic factor usage received flexible policy tolerance during the CBAM transitional period, but the 2026 official compliance phase imposes strict restrictions on such practices. Current regulatory requirements prioritize facility-specific and batch-based emission data to support credible tax assessment, while generic data tends to overestimate actual carbon output and bring extra tax burdens for importers.
Partial emission scope disclosure represents another prevalent reporting defect in daily forwarding operations. Many compliance teams only submit verified scope 1 direct production emissions while excluding scope 2 indirect energy consumption emissions. According to European Commission 2025 updated CBAM fiscal guidelines, incomplete scope disclosure prompts customs systems to adopt conservative industry benchmark values for supplementary calculation, which lifts carbon tax obligations artificially for non-compliant declaration records.
Minor commodity classification deviations also produce measurable hidden tax costs. Each CBAM-regulated product category corresponds to independent carbon tax calculation benchmarks and assessment brackets. Mismatched CN code classification leads to inappropriate tax bracket matching, generating excess tax payments that are difficult to recover fully through post-clearance amendment applications.

Excessive carbon adjustment tariff payouts: Imprecise supply chain emission reporting causes EU customs systems to apply relatively high carbon adjustment rates compared with actual shipment carbon output. According to European Commission 2025 CBAM fiscal monitoring data, shipments with inconsistent emission declarations generate tariff overpayments ranging from 2% to 6% of total cargo value on average. Such excess charges constitute non-recoverable hidden costs for importers and their cooperative forwarding service providers.
Administrative fees for compliance rectification: Submissions with data inconsistencies under EU CBAM Supply Chain Reporting Rules require formal amendment reviews and compliance verification procedures. Each rectification application generates corresponding administrative processing fees, and cumulative costs become notable for forwarders managing large-volume EU shipment portfolios. Repeated revisions also increase internal labor and time costs for compliance teams.
Storage and demurrage increments from clearance delays: Reporting non-compliance triggers cargo inspection holds and extends terminal dwelling cycles. According to UNCTAD 2025 maritime logistics reports, CBAM-related clearance delays bring additional port handling costs ranging from 12% to 18% compared with standard clearance scenarios. These incidental charges belong to unbudgeted hidden expenditures for cross-border logistics operations.
Retroactive tax settlements from regular audits: EU customs authorities conduct quarterly targeted audits on historical CBAM shipment records. Undeclared emission items or underreported carbon volumes identified in audits require supplementary tax settlements plus low-rate adjustment interest. These retroactive liabilities create unplanned financial pressure for forwarders and long-term industrial clients.

What daily operational errors raise CBAM hidden tax liabilities?
Recurring operational errors in supply chain data collection and compliance management push up implicit CBAM tax risks for global freight forwarders. Most of these problems originate from outdated workflows designed for pre-CBAM trade environments.
A common mistake is that many forwarding teams regard CBAM documentation as a routine administrative procedure rather than a core financial control link. Operational staff often prioritize clearance efficiency while ignoring data precision, which exerts direct impacts on final carbon tax expenditure.
Mechanistic reuse of historical shipment data: Applying emission data from previous shipments without real-time supplier confirmation generates outdated declaration records. Industrial production carbon emission levels change with energy structure adjustment and production efficiency optimization, making static historical data unsuitable for current tax calculation scenarios.
Decentralized supply chain data collection: Unorganized supplier communication mechanisms lead to incomplete emission data sets. Missing partial emission indicators trigger conservative tax assessment modes in EU customs systems and increase overall import costs.
Absence of pre-submission internal audits: Skipping internal data verification before official declaration raises the probability of inconsistent report content. Unchecked errors lead to post-clearance rectification demands, audit costs and cumulative hidden tax increments.
Disregard of regulatory benchmark updates: EU carbon emission calculation benchmarks and tax parameters receive quarterly routine revisions. Failure to update declaration standards in line with new rules causes non-compliant submissions and inappropriate tax assessment under updated EU CBAM Supply Chain Reporting Rules.
